The “Fill a Backpack” event organized by The Restoring Hope Foundation is an annual initiative aimed at gathering school supplies to fill backpacks for local schools and families in need. This event serves as a pivotal moment for the community to come together and support education by ensuring that students have the necessary tools to succeed in their academic endeavors.
Months before the start of the school year, the foundation launches a campaign to raise awareness and collect donations for the “Fill a Backpack” event. Through various channels, including social media, partnerships with local businesses, schools, and community organizations, they spread the word about the importance of providing students with the essential supplies needed for learning.
As the collection period reaches its peak, volunteers sort through the donated items, categorizing them and ensuring that each backpack will be equipped with a diverse array of necessary supplies suitable for different age groups and grade levels. The atmosphere is bustling with enthusiasm and a sense of purpose as volunteers come together to prepare the backpacks.
Finally, on a designated day before the start of the school year, a celebratory event takes place. Families and volunteers gather to fill the backpacks with care and dedication.
Representatives from local schools and educational institutions are invited to receive the backpacks, ensuring that they reach the hands of students who will benefit from them the most.
